The Perils of Live Battery Swaps

Why is disconnecting a battery while the engine is running generally considered a bad idea? Several factors contribute to the risk:

  • Voltage Spikes: When the battery is disconnected‚ the alternator suddenly becomes the sole power source․ Alternators are designed to regulate voltage‚ but without the battery acting as a buffer‚ voltage spikes become far more likely․ These spikes can fry sensitive electronic components‚ including the car’s computer (ECU)‚ entertainment system‚ and sensors․
  • Alternator Overload: The alternator is built to charge the battery and supply power to the car’s electrical system *in conjunction* with the battery; Suddenly asking it to handle the entire load without the battery’s assistance can overload it‚ potentially leading to premature failure․
  • Risk of Electric Shock: While a car battery’s voltage (typically 12V) isn’t usually fatal‚ it can still deliver a painful shock‚ especially if there are any exposed connections or damaged wiring․
  • Potential for Short Circuits: Accidental contact between the disconnected battery terminals and the car’s chassis can create a short circuit‚ leading to sparks‚ fire‚ and damage to the electrical system․

Safe Alternatives: The Right Way to Change a Car Battery

Fortunately‚ there are much safer and more reliable methods for changing your car battery․ These methods prioritize safety and protect your vehicle’s delicate electronics․

Step-by-Step Guide to Safe Battery Replacement

  1. Turn Off the Engine: This is the most crucial step․ Ensure the ignition is completely off and the keys are removed․
  2. Gather Your Tools: You’ll need wrenches (usually metric) to loosen the battery terminals and hold-down clamp․ Safety glasses and gloves are also recommended․
  3. Disconnect the Negative Terminal First: Always disconnect the negative (-) terminal first․ This minimizes the risk of a short circuit when disconnecting the positive (+) terminal․
  4. Disconnect the Positive Terminal: Once the negative terminal is disconnected‚ you can safely disconnect the positive (+) terminal․
  5. Remove the Battery Hold-Down: This clamp secures the battery in place․ Remove it carefully․
  6. Lift Out the Old Battery: Batteries can be heavy‚ so lift with your legs‚ not your back․ Dispose of the old battery responsibly (most auto parts stores will recycle them)․
  7. Clean the Terminals: Use a wire brush or terminal cleaner to remove any corrosion from the battery terminals and connectors․
  8. Install the New Battery: Place the new battery in the tray and secure it with the hold-down clamp․
  9. Connect the Positive Terminal First: Connect the positive (+) terminal first‚ ensuring a secure connection․
  10. Connect the Negative Terminal: Connect the negative (-) terminal last․
  11. Verify Connections: Double-check that all connections are tight and secure․

Memory Savers: Preserving Your Car’s Settings

If you’re concerned about losing your car’s settings (radio presets‚ seat positions‚ etc․)‚ you can use a “memory saver․” These devices plug into the cigarette lighter or OBD-II port and provide a temporary power source while the battery is disconnected․ This prevents the loss of volatile memory․

Choosing the correct replacement battery is also crucial․ Refer to your owner’s manual or consult with an auto parts professional to ensure you select a battery with the appropriate cold cranking amps (CCA) and reserve capacity for your vehicle’s needs․ Using an undersized battery can lead to starting problems‚ especially in cold weather‚ while an oversized battery may not properly fit in the battery tray or be compatible with the charging system․

TROUBLESHOOTING COMMON ISSUES AFTER BATTERY REPLACEMENT
Even with careful attention to detail‚ some minor issues can arise after replacing a car battery․ Being prepared to address these problems can save you time and frustration․

ADDRESSING RESET ELECTRONICS

– Radio Code: Some radios require a security code after a power loss․ Consult your owner’s manual or contact your dealership for the code․
– Window Auto-Up/Down: The auto-up/down feature on some windows may need to be reset․ Typically‚ this involves holding the window switch in the up position for a few seconds after the window is fully closed․ Refer to your owner’s manual for specific instructions․
– Idle Learn Procedure: Some vehicles‚ particularly those with electronic throttle control‚ may need to relearn the idle speed after a battery disconnect․ This often involves letting the engine idle for a specific period after starting․ Again‚ consult your owner’s manual․

CHECKING FOR PROPER CHARGING

After replacing the battery‚ it’s a good idea to check the charging system voltage․ You can use a multimeter to measure the voltage at the battery terminals while the engine is running․ A healthy charging system should typically read between 13․5 and 14․5 volts․ If the voltage is significantly higher or lower‚ it could indicate a problem with the alternator or voltage regulator․

LONG-TERM BATTERY CARE

Proper battery maintenance can extend the life of your car battery and prevent unexpected breakdowns․
– Keep Terminals Clean: Regularly clean the battery terminals to prevent corrosion buildup․
– Avoid Short Trips: Frequent short trips don’t allow the battery enough time to fully recharge․ If you primarily drive short distances‚ consider using a battery maintainer or trickle charger periodically․
– Limit Accessory Use While Idling: Excessive use of accessories like headlights‚ air conditioning‚ and the radio while the engine is idling can strain the battery․
– Regular Battery Testing: Have your battery tested periodically‚ especially as it approaches the end of its expected lifespan (typically 3-5 years)․ Most auto parts stores offer free battery testing services․
